package requests
import (
"encoding/json"
"testing"
"time"
)
func TestFlexibleDate_UnmarshalJSON_DateOnly(t *testing.T) {
var fd FlexibleDate
err := fd.UnmarshalJSON([]byte(`"2025-11-27"`))
if err != nil {
t.Fatalf("unexpected error: %v", err)
}
want := time.Date(2025, 11, 27, 0, 0, 0, 0, time.UTC)
if !fd.Time.Equal(want) {
t.Errorf("got %v, want %v", fd.Time, want)
}
}
func TestFlexibleDate_UnmarshalJSON_RFC3339(t *testing.T) {
var fd FlexibleDate
err := fd.UnmarshalJSON([]byte(`"2025-11-27T15:30:00Z"`))
if err != nil {
t.Fatalf("unexpected error: %v", err)
}
want := time.Date(2025, 11, 27, 15, 30, 0, 0, time.UTC)
if !fd.Time.Equal(want) {
t.Errorf("got %v, want %v", fd.Time, want)
}
}
func TestFlexibleDate_UnmarshalJSON_Null(t *testing.T) {
var fd FlexibleDate
err := fd.UnmarshalJSON([]byte(`null`))
if err != nil {
t.Fatalf("unexpected error: %v", err)
}
if !fd.Time.IsZero() {
t.Errorf("expected zero time, got %v", fd.Time)
}
}
func TestFlexibleDate_UnmarshalJSON_EmptyString(t *testing.T) {
var fd FlexibleDate
err := fd.UnmarshalJSON([]byte(`""`))
if err != nil {
t.Fatalf("unexpected error: %v", err)
}
if !fd.Time.IsZero() {
t.Errorf("expected zero time, got %v", fd.Time)
}
}
func TestFlexibleDate_UnmarshalJSON_Invalid(t *testing.T) {
var fd FlexibleDate
err := fd.UnmarshalJSON([]byte(`"not-a-date"`))
if err == nil {
t.Fatal("expected error for invalid date, got nil")
}
}
func TestFlexibleDate_MarshalJSON_Valid(t *testing.T) {
fd := FlexibleDate{Time: time.Date(2025, 11, 27, 15, 30, 0, 0, time.UTC)}
data, err := fd.MarshalJSON()
if err != nil {
t.Fatalf("unexpected error: %v", err)
}
var s string
if err := json.Unmarshal(data, &s); err != nil {
t.Fatalf("result is not a JSON string: %v", err)
}
want := "2025-11-27T15:30:00Z"
if s != want {
t.Errorf("got %q, want %q", s, want)
}
}
func TestFlexibleDate_MarshalJSON_Zero(t *testing.T) {
fd := FlexibleDate{}
data, err := fd.MarshalJSON()
if err != nil {
t.Fatalf("unexpected error: %v", err)
}
if string(data) != "null" {
t.Errorf("got %s, want null", string(data))
}
}
func TestFlexibleDate_ToTimePtr_Valid(t *testing.T) {
fd := &FlexibleDate{Time: time.Date(2025, 11, 27, 0, 0, 0, 0, time.UTC)}
ptr := fd.ToTimePtr()
if ptr == nil {
t.Fatal("expected non-nil pointer")
}
if !ptr.Equal(fd.Time) {
t.Errorf("got %v, want %v", *ptr, fd.Time)
}
}
func TestFlexibleDate_ToTimePtr_Zero(t *testing.T) {
fd := &FlexibleDate{}
ptr := fd.ToTimePtr()
if ptr != nil {
t.Errorf("expected nil, got %v", *ptr)
}
}
func TestFlexibleDate_ToTimePtr_NilReceiver(t *testing.T) {
var fd *FlexibleDate
ptr := fd.ToTimePtr()
if ptr != nil {
t.Errorf("expected nil for nil receiver, got %v", *ptr)
}
}
func TestFlexibleDate_RoundTrip(t *testing.T) {
original := FlexibleDate{Time: time.Date(2025, 6, 15, 10, 0, 0, 0, time.UTC)}
data, err := original.MarshalJSON()
if err != nil {
t.Fatalf("marshal error: %v", err)
}
var restored FlexibleDate
if err := restored.UnmarshalJSON(data); err != nil {
t.Fatalf("unmarshal error: %v", err)
}
if !original.Time.Equal(restored.Time) {
t.Errorf("round-trip mismatch: original %v, restored %v", original.Time, restored.Time)
}
}
